Transaction 651184421e8f68637d7e4aaa48b1181abc5bf87d9378e25595dea08988fbb18d
1 Input
1 Output
-
651184421e8f68637d7e4aaa48b1181abc5bf87d9378e25595dea08988fbb18d:0
- value
- 1607642
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c193104b392f58f6c361428683c4c83b32b8551 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KcB2U9HqpA8dNgL2TRHrbVt367jMAJXT8